Hi,
In the back end (administrator) I cannot add users. (control panel > users)
You cannot add users in Phoca Download as Phoca Download uses Joomla! users - it is a part of Joomla! so users can be added in Joomla! user manager.

In Phoca Download you only see users who have uploaded something to Phoca Download.

500 error - enable php error reporting and debug mode to see what error you get there:
https://www.phoca.cz/documents/16-joomla ... rs-on-site

Batch method is supported since Joomla! 1.7

Displaying categories in UCP in frontend - only published categories where you select the user to have upload rights are displayed there.
